FAQ : Why aren't my games saving properly?

Despite all the things we have done in terms of the coding and structure of the game, some things can still compromise your game saves.

This is mostly due to the vagaries of browsers.
The first thing to make sure of is that you are using Mozilla Firefox.

If you are using Firefox then there are a few things that you can do to prevent game save issues.

Account email
For some reason the database does not like any email address which starts with or contains capital letters.
While you should be able to log into the website, you won't see your playername, credits or any game saves. This is simply because the website won't recognise the email address on the database so it won't connect.
If you think that this applies to you, then please contact me via Direct Message on Patreon and we can resolve it for you. 

Cookie caching and cookie limits
Each game play creates the cookies required to make the game function.
There is a limit to how many cookies any browser can handle in a session. For Firefox, that's about 150 cookies.

Once that limit is reached, no more cookies can be stored, and new cookies begin replacing the old ones abitrarily.

An incomplete and inaccurate array of data can then stored in game saves.

Each chapter start point has some coding which clears any upcoming cookies which are due to be used in that chapter. Any cookies from previous chapters may still be present in your browser cache and may not be cleared.

What should I do?
The best way to prevent this is to make sure you clear out cookies between game saves.
Closing and then reopening Firefox should clear your cache.
But to really make sure that you start each chapter with a clear cache simply do the following.

In Firefox > Go to the three lines in the top right corner > History > Clear recent history... > Select 'Cookies' and then 'Clear Now'.

This will clear all the cookies from your browser cache. You can select how far back you want to clear the cache.

If you do this before you start any chapter, you can guarantee that only the cookies required are being used.

What else should I avoid?
Once you have a nice clear cache it's important to avoid a few other things.
Running the game/website in more than one browser tab or window can 'cross contaminate' your game plays.
The browser cannot differentiate between one tab or window and will add whatever cookies it finds to the same cache.

When you make a game save or load in, the cookies from any other tabs/windows can also end up being included in the saved or loaded game.
If you make a game save which has an innaccurate array of cookies then it will always contain an inaccurate array of cookies.
That can have a detrimental effect on future chapters if you subsequently play on from that save.

So please run the website in just one window or tab at a time!

I have many older saved games, will that cause any problems?
The dsp3000.games website was lauched in April 2022 and has been continously developed since then.
Along the way we have identified and fixed several issues and continue to develop the platform.
There have been a few significant updates which resolved some earlier problems, however some older save may still contain historical issues contained within their data array.

Any game saved before January 2023 is very likely to have innaccurate data.
Games saved before August 12th 2023 are also likely to have some issues particularly around Ch9 and Ch10.  
Another update completed November 11th 2023 further reduced the number of cookies and variables generated during each gameplay.

For this reason, we recommend deleting older saves before August 2023 and especially before January 2023.

Large amounts of saved games can also slow down the connection between the website and database too. This can slow down you playing experience and also negatively impact on game saving and loading.
